Package: acpi-support Version: 0.114-1 Severity: important Hello,
Upgrading to this version on my Thinkpad R61 has following problems: - vt is not switched to 7 (pressing Alt+F7 will fix this) - module iwlagn is not reloaded (modprobe iwlagn is enough) - PCM volume is set to 0, Master is set to 0 and muted There might be other issues, but these are the one I noticed since the upgrade. Downgrading to 0.109-11 fixes everything, so I'll stick to that version until this is fixed, but I'm happy to test new packages if needed.
